FOOT GROUND, HEEL
Description:
The 17200 and 17202 Foot Grounders provide a continuous ground path between an
operator and a properly grounded ESD protected flooring. These foot grounders are
designed for use on standard shoes. They can be easily adjusted to fit most individuals.
Desco’s foot grounders have a lining that prevents carbon marks on shoes. Foot grounder models
17200 and 17202 have discrete resistors built into the contact strip. Model 17200 has a one
megohm resistor and model 17202 has a two megohm resistor. The product has been tested to
ESD STM97.2 - Floor Materials and Footwear Voltage Measurement in Combination with a Person.
It is a suitable ESD footwear component in Flooring - Footwear System when used as the primary
grounding method (<3.5 x 10E7 ohms per ESD STM 97.1 Floor Materials and Footwear-Resistance
Measurement in Combination with a Person.)
Components:
A. 0.060” thick (± 0.005), 1" wide contact area
a. Outer black layer is conductive neoprene.
b. Inner layer is insulative neoprene.
c. Tear resistant nylon reinforced 4.3 oz. inner scrim layer prevents the rubber from tearing.
B. 3/8" wide, 30" long blue nylon ribbon contains 8 electrically conductive carbon suffused fibers,
reversible, may be positioned on either side of foot.
C. 3/4" wide blue non-elastic hook material.
D. 3/4" wide blue stretch loop material, for quick and easy attachment to foot.

Specifications
Tab to floor contact point: 1 x 10E6 < 1 x10E8 ohms resistance when measured
per ESD SP9.2 & ESD TR53
Outside Layer Test Method
Abrasion: 3000 cycles ASTM-D-3389 Method B
Hardness: 70 Shore A ASTM-D-2240
Tensile PSI (min): 2500lbs. ASTM-D-412
Note:
“For standing operations, personnel shall be grounded via a wrist strap
system or by a flooring/footwear system.” (ANSI/ESDS20.20)
“ESD footwear should be tested at least daily while worn. See ESD TR53”
(ESD Handbook TR20.20 section 5.3.3.4)
“Heel and toe grounders shall be worn on both feet to insure effective
use.” (ESD Handbook ESD TR20.20-2008 section 5.3.3.3.4 Footwear
Proper Usage)
